Just had a message that Roger Caddy has passed away.

Roger played for Nanpean Rovers in the mid to late sixties, hard tackling full back and could kick the heavy leather ball from one end of Victoria Bottoms to the other.

Played Cricket also for St.Austell, again he could throw from the outfield as fast and accurate as anyone in the County. 

Enjoyed his pint and cards at 'The Grenville'  and many many other watering holes, a real character, will be sadly missed but always remembered.

Lived most of his life in Bodmin which others may like to expand on.

RIP.
